    I am having a bit of a problem. First of all, the plug-in works great! It was easy to install, set-up, and use. It is a great plug-in, however the issue I am having I think is actually embedded in the theme that I have been using.

    When I choose to hide the menu navigation in my theme, it displays a short-cut for every page that I have on my website in the navigational menu instead. I thought by unchecking the “Navigational Menu” it would disappear, but it only messed things up.

    I have been trying to hide the menu, especially from the mobile end of it, and have had no luck. I know very little about CSS editing and I don’t want to mess things up. Could someone please tell me how I can hide the themed menu so I can use the ShiftNav instead? Thank you in advance for any help that I can get….

    I resolved the issue! I just had to find the name of the menu in my theme. I did so by opening my website on the laptop and right-clicked “inspect element” There I found the name of the menu. Inserted it in the setting and the old navigation bar disappeared!
